What Is Modafinil?
Modafinil is a wakefulness-promoting medication that affects certain neurotransmitters in the brain associated with alertness and cognitive function. Unlike traditional stimulants, modafinil has a unique mechanism of action and is often prescribed to help manage excessive sleepiness caused by specific medical conditions.
Common approved uses of modafinil include:
- Narcolepsy
- Shift Work Sleep Disorder (SWSD)
-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A)-related sleepiness
Modafinil should only be used under medical supervision and according to prescribed instructions.
What Is Modalert?
Modalert is a brand of modafinil manufactured by the pharmaceutical company Sun Pharmaceutical Industries.
It is one of the most recognized modafinil brands and is widely discussed among patients who have been prescribed wakefulness-promoting therapy.
Modalert contains the same active ingredient found in other modafinil products and is commonly available in strengths such as:
- 100 mg
- 200 mg
Many users associate Modalert with consistent quality and effectiveness when prescribed appropriately.
What Is Modvigil?
Modvigil is another brand of modafinil manufactured by HAB Pharmaceuticals & Research Ltd..
Like Modalert, Modvigil contains modafinil as its active ingredient and is intended to promote wakefulness in individuals diagnosed with approved sleep-related conditions.
Modvigil is often considered a more affordable alternative while still delivering the same active compound.

Key Differences Between Modalert and Modvigil
Although the active ingredient is the same, there are some practical differences.
Manufacturer
The primary difference is the pharmaceutical company producing the medication.
- Modalert: Manufactured by Sun Pharmaceutical Industries
- Modvigil: Manufactured by HAB Pharmaceuticals & Research Ltd.
Pricing
Modvigil is often marketed at a lower price point compared to Modalert, making it a popular option for cost-conscious consumers.
Inactive Ingredients
While the active ingredient remains the same, inactive ingredients, fillers, and manufacturing processes may differ slightly.
These differences generally do not significantly affect therapeutic outcomes but may influence individual preferences.

Possible Side Effects
Like all medications, Modalert and Modvigil may cause side effects.
Common Side Effects
- Headache
- Nausea
- Dizziness
- Dry mouth
- Insomnia
- Nervousness
- Reduced appetite
These side effects are usually mild and may improve as the body adjusts to treatment.
Less Common Side Effects
- Anxiety
- Increased heart rate
- Stomach discomfort
- Sweating
- Restlessness
Serious Side Effects
Seek immediate medical attention if you experience:
- Severe skin rash
- Allergic reactions
- Chest pain
- Difficulty breathing
- Significant mood changes
- Suicidal thoughts
Although rare, these reactions require urgent medical evaluation.

Drug Interactions
Modafinil may interact with various medications.
Potential interactions include:
- Hormonal contraceptives
- Certain antidepressants
- Blood thinners
- Anti-seizure medications
- Some antifungal medications
Always provide a complete list of medications and supplements to your healthcare provider before starting treatment.
